Santa Barbara Botanical Garden
The Santa Barbara Botanic Garden, founded in 1926, is dedicated to scientific research, education, conservation and display of California plants featuring over 1,000 taxa of native plants across 78 acres. The Garden is replacing an antiquated irrigation system with a technologically sophisticated, centrally controlled water delivery method. The new computerized process will allow individual irrigation regimes to specially meet the needs of diverse plant collections and displays. Plant losses due to irrigation problems will be significantly reduced.
The Hind Foundation has provided an $116,000 grant for Phase Two of the system’s installation.
